ABOUT THIS BRACELET

Victorian opulent hinged bangle bracelet with rich cobalt blue enameling inset with a diamond set wreath motif. This bracelet is silver and 14K rose gold and is finished with fine foliate motif engraved details, hidden box clasp. The length is 2 1/4 on the inside of the bangle.The Diamonds are described as follows:Thirty Four Old Mine Cut DiamondsWeight: 2.50 carats total weightColor: H-JClarity: VS-SI

About Victorian Jewelry

The eclectic Victorians didn’t limit themselves when it came to motifs and themes—if it struck their fancy, they turned it into jewelry. Sweet and sentimental with a distinct romantic streak, Victorian gems expanded upon their Georgian predecessors. The array of styles that blossomed (sometimes quite literally) during this era endure to this day.
